Weeeeeeell, we do depend on a bunch of stuff outside GNOME in the Desktop
release, such as Mozilla. But we can only do so because we don't rely on
API/ABI stability, or their release cycles, etc. (Epiphany works with so
many versions of Mozilla/Firefox it's not funny.)

Do we want Galago in the GNOME Platform suite? Then it'll need to be in the
Desktop suite for a while first.

Will the non-GNOME parts of Galago be in the freedesktop.org Platform? Once
we trust the freedesktop.org Platform release process, we can depend on it
instead of bringing Galago into the GNOME release cycle.

There are a few possible solutions - gotta figure out what we want to
achieve first.
